Carol Sue (Thompson) Turner, age 84, passed away peacefully in her home on October 10th in Wellington, Florida. Sue is survived by her husband Robert (Bob) C. Turner, son Gregory Turner, daughter Elaine Roberti, and son David Turner. She has four grandchildren, seven great grandchildren, and one great grandchild.
Sue was born in McAlester, Oklahoma on September 30, 1936 to Louis and Ester Thompson. She graduated from McAlester High School in 1955. She went on to attend Eastern Oklahoma College and worked at the First National Bank.
She married Bob in 1958 and they were married for 62 years. She was a Navy wife and moved often, living in California, Washington State, Virginia, Rhode Island and Florida.
She is preceded by her parents, Louis and Ester Thompson, brother Bob Thompson, sister Barbra Steidley, and daughter Julie Ann.
A private service will be held on October 20th at Palms West Funeral Home in Wellington, Florida, followed by burial at a later date in McAlester.
